You may have a passive keyless system on your Toyota that locks and unlocks the doors when the key fob is close proximity to the vehicle. This is a great option to secure your vehicle when it's parked somewhere unfamiliar however, it has its limitations.
Passive keyless entry systems use radio frequency (RFID or Bluetooth) to send signals to unlock the door and turn on the ignition when the owner is within the vehicle. They aren't as vulnerable to hacking as traditional remote control systems, however there is still the possibility that someone will deliberately duplicate the transmitter signal and send it back at a later date. This is referred to as replay attacks, and it can be prevented by utilizing the latest technology in your car's keyless system.

Reprogramming
Modern car keys have much more than the actual part of the key that turns it into the ignition. It also has an electronic receiver, transmitter and a form of coding to communicate with your car. Reprogramming can be costly because the code has to meet strict requirements. It could take some time as well, because it requires the use of special equipment. Dealers might be able to help but they need to purchase parts frequently and deal with delays. In this situation, a locksmith is the best option.
